Every entrepreneur faces a crossroads where risk, resilience, and responsibility converge. For Eduard Khemchan, those three pillars are not just part of business—they are guiding principles that shape how he approaches life and leadership.

From his humble beginnings to his role in today’s financial and technological arenas, Eduard has consistently shown how balancing bold decisions with a sense of duty can create lasting impact.

Eduard’s first lessons in resilience came long before he entered boardrooms or trading platforms. As a young boy who moved from Georgia to the United States, he was thrust into a new culture and new challenges at just twelve years old.

By the age of thirteen, he was delivering newspapers in the early hours of the morning, learning what it meant to push through discomfort and honour commitments. These formative experiences taught him that life rarely unfolds without obstacles, but persistence has the power to transform setbacks into stepping stones.

When Eduard launched his first business in construction at twenty-one, risk was inevitable. He invested his energy, resources, and vision into building something from the ground up. Success in his very first year was not the result of chance alone—it was the product of long hours, careful decisions, and an ability to adapt quickly.

What set Eduard Khemchan apart, even then, was his awareness that risk must be matched with responsibility. He understood that clients, employees, and partners placed their trust in him, and that trust had to be honoured.

That balance became even more important as Eduard stepped into the world of finance. The late 1990s and early 2000s were a period of rapid transformation, with e-trading platforms democratizing access to markets.

Eduard was among the early adopters exploring stocks, options, and forex. The risks were real: volatile markets, untested technologies, and minimal safety nets. Yet resilience kept him in the game, and responsibility kept him grounded.

He never viewed trading as a gamble but as a discipline—one where risk had to be managed with knowledge, preparation, and accountability.

As the financial landscape evolved, Eduard expanded into new frontiers—cryptocurrency, artificial intelligence, and blockchain. These technologies carried enormous potential but also significant uncertainty.

Eduard welcomed the unknown not as a threat but as an opportunity to innovate responsibly. He has often emphasized that risk without resilience can lead to recklessness, while innovation without responsibility can erode trust. For him, true leadership requires all three working in harmony.Eduard Khemchan
